Introduce a headless `flutter test` suite (83 tests) covering models, utilities, every API endpoint, and the five screens, with shared helpers and fixtures so new tests stay terse. API endpoint methods are statically-dispatched extensions on the BackendAPI singleton, so they cannot be mocked via `implements`. Mock at the Dio HTTP-adapter layer (http_mock_adapter) instead, enabled by two small @visibleForTesting seams: BackendAPI.dioForTesting swaps the singleton's Dio, and BackendReachability.forceOnlineForTesting() forces a deterministic online state so polling widgets load.
